Mostly you will see women wearing headgear on weekend during important ceremony. The gele is considered to be part of traditional womenswear in most African countries, and is usually the indicator of fancy dress; much like a fascinator or a hat is in the Western world. It has been worn by women for decades, but in recent years have become the ultimate fashion accessory for parties – your slay game is directly proportionate to how well your gele is tied. The invention of Auto Gele serves as a game changer; as they provide ready-to-wear geles, tied to perfection and all you need to do is fasten it at the back! This invention will enable you tied your flamboyant gele yourself in just a minute unlike before that you have to spend an average 20 minutes.
